> The Completion_rest_engraver will do that in a variety of manners
> (depending on the variables it uses to make its decisions). It's not
> all that popular outside of computer-generated music where barlines and
> other metric boundaries are more of a coincidence and a help to the
> human executioner rather than an integral part of the rhythm.
Thanks for reminding me of its existence; I use neither Completion_*_engraver.
Now:
\version "2.19.80"
\layout {
\context {
\Voice
\consists "Completion_rest_engraver"
}
}
{
\time 4/4
c'4
}
I believe Reggie would like the rest of that measure filled with rests (I’m
guessing a quarter rest and a half rest).
